SEATTLE — Jordan Morris had not started a match at CenturyLink Field for the Seattle Sounders in 538 days entering Saturday’s home opener against FC Cincinnati. In front of an announced crowd of 39,011, Morris made up for lost time, bagging a brace as the hosts took an emphatic 4-1 victory over the MLS debutants. […]

Bertrand Owundi Eko’o wasn’t hard to pick out at Minnesota United practice Tuesday at the National Sports Center. The Cameroonian center back, at 6-2. 190 pounds, is easily one of the biggest guys on the team.
